Cost Structure Across Economies

Every manufacturer tries to cut a deal between overhead and input costs. China, India, Vietnam, and Indonesia get an edge through low power bills, proximity to oil refining complexes, and—until recent years—more manageable environmental taxes. In contrast, Germany, Japan, the United States, and South Korea juggle high labor, restrictive waste disposal, and stricter GMP protocols. Raw materials prices, ranging from the cost spikes following disruptions in Russian gas supplies to inflation surges in Argentina and Turkey, constantly reshape the balance.

Polyamide curing agent prices bottomed out in the first half of 2022 after the pandemic cooled global demand. By late 2022 and through 2023, European and North American producers raised prices more than 20% due to inflation, raw material shortages, and ongoing shipping bottlenecks from the Suez canal to Californian ports. China saw quicker rebounds, as domestic supply chains kicked back into gear, but new costs in waste remediation and labor reforms have put upward pressure on prices since mid-2023. In Brazil, Nigeria, and South Africa, costs fluctuated more due to currency volatility and imported raw materials, yet local suppliers often managed to carve smaller, flexible production batches for nearby markets.

Two Years of Market Price Twists and a Look at What’s Next

Since the second half of 2022, global polyamide curing agent prices have shifted higher almost everywhere. China’s price increases felt lighter, as larger inventories and new plant investments helped even out shocks. Costs in Germany, France, and Italy climbed faster, riding the tailwinds of broader inflation and Europe’s tighter energy markets. United States suppliers carried both inflation and wage pressure, with higher carrier rates feeding into delivered price increases. Some relief appeared in Australia, Chile, and South Africa, as new local production displaced imports.

Looking to 2024 and beyond, inflation and raw material contests linger in the background. Currency wobbles in Argentina, Nigeria, and Egypt skew forecasts, while tight environmental rules in the European Union press costs upward across France, Italy, Spain, and the Netherlands. In China, new environmental levies and urban wage pressures encourage more automation, likely slowing but not reversing price increases. India’s growing appetite and expanding middle class promise stronger demand, so local prices may outpace inflation by a few points. Across Vietnam, Malaysia, Thailand, and Singapore, price movements track global shipping and commodity swings, but their nimble scale helps adjust faster than giants like the United States or Brazil.
